Skip to content

Questions fréquentes (FAQ)

J'ai tout bien câblé... mais mes moteurs vibrent grossièrement mais ne tournent pas : c'est quoi le problème ?

Il y a 2 causes principales à une vibration grossière voire une rotation erratique des moteurs pas à pas :

  • la première, par ordre de fréquence, c'est la masse commune mal câblée entre les étages. Il faut être extrêmement pointilleux sur ce point, notamment dans le cas d'un câblage sur drivers externe. Il y a effectivement de nombreuses broches qui sont câblées en commun à la masse logique (ou GND) et on se retrouve à devoir engager plusieurs câbles dans un même bornier, source potentielle de faux contact. Personnellement, j'ai pris l'habitude de souder les câbles qui vont ensemble dans un même bornier, comme çà je suis sûr du contact. Il faut également vérifier que tous les points câblés en commun sont effectivement en contact : à l'aide d'un ohmètre, on doit avoir le contact entre 2 points les plus éloignés du câblage commun et entre n'importe quels autres points du câblage commun (faire quelques tests au hasard qui doivent tous donner 0 au ohmètre).

  • La seconde cause, presque aussi fréquente que la première, c'est une phase du moteur qui est mal câblée :

    • soit parce que le câble lui-même est mal connecté ou n'est pas continu
    • soit parce que les phases elles-mêmes sont mal câblées. Un moteur pas à pas c'est 2 bobines en interne, chaque bobine étant appelée "phase". Logiquement, les 4 fils du moteurs vont par paire, 1 paire par bobine : les 2 câbles qui vont ensemble sont en contact interne ce qui se vérifie aisément à l'aide d'un ohmètre. Une fois les câbles de phases bien repérés, il faut câbler sur A+/A- les 2 câble d'une phase et sur B+/B- les 2 autres câbles de l'autre phase.

Le(s) moteur(s) tournent dans le mauvais sens : que faire ?

Les choses sont simples :

  • mettre l'alimentation moteur hors tension

  • recâbler correctement les câbles en les inversant : si c'est branché en 1-2-3-4, il faut simplement rebrancher en 4-3-2-1. Ceci correspond à un retournement du l'embout de connexion.

Mes moteurs chauffent fortement après quelques minutes : est-ce normal ?

En fonctionnement normal, les moteurs pas à pas doivent rester froids voire être tièdes, mais ne pas être chauds. Cela risquerait d'ailleurs de les dégrader mécaniquement à long terme.

Première cause possible, c'est que l'intensité de phase est trop élevée. Cela se règle :

  • soit sur l'étage moteur via un petit potentiomètre si c'est un pololu...
  • ou bien soit par un switch si c'est un étage externe.

Seconde possibilité : vos moteurs subissent une forte contrainte mécanique et l'opposition au mouvement les fait chauffer. Vérifier manuellement et hors tension que les axes mécaniques tournent librement et libérer ce qui doit l'être le cas échéant.

Autre possibilité : vos moteurs restent engagés électriquement à l'arrêt (c'est parfois voire souvent souhaitable), et cela les fait chauffer au fil du temps. Ce point rejoint l'intensité de phase qui est probablement trop élevée.

Info

La chaleur au toucher du moteur en fonctionnement est au final d'ailleurs un bon moyen de régler l'intensité de phase optimale : viser une température légèrement tiède pour avoir l'intensité de phase la plus élevée et donc le couple le plus élevé possible mais sans compromettre le fonctionnement du moteur.